Events
Filter events
Wednesday, April 23, 2025
Cancelled
–
City Centre Branch
–
City Centre Branch
–
Community Event
–
Semiahmoo Branch
–
Newton Branch
–
Cloverdale Branch
–
Newton Branch
Thursday, April 24, 2025
–
Semiahmoo Branch
–
Cloverdale Branch